ABOUT AMINE BENDAHOU

Fueled by a deep commitment to transforming healthcare through education and pioneering research, I am Dr. Amine Bendahou, currently serving as a Training & Education Specialist at the International Society for Cell & Gene Therapy (ISCT). My expertise in cancer biology, genomics, and clinical research is complemented by a dedication to bridging the gap between scientific discovery and patient-centered clinical applications.Throughout my career, I\'ve made impactful strides in unraveling the molecular underpinnings of cancer at esteemed institutions such as the Cleveland Clinic, NIH, Cold Spring Harbor Lab, and UBC. Utilizing advanced genomic technologies, I have led research initiatives to identify biomarkers that drive personalized treatment and early detection strategies, aiming to reshape clinical care for patients globally.In my current role, I leverage my project management acumen and interdisciplinary collaboration skills to foster knowledge sharing in cell and gene therapy. This position at ISCT allows me to work at the intersection of education, innovation, and therapeutic development—a space where I believe meaningful advancements for patient health outcomes truly begin.I welcome the chance to connect with others passionate about collaboration, cutting-edge research, and the advancement of cell and gene therapy.
